What is the molar mass of pentane?

Pentane, represented by the molecular formula C5H12, contains five atoms of carbon and 12 atoms of hydrogen. Since the atomic weight of carbon is about 12.01, the total mass of carbon in pentane is 60.05 grams per mole, differing slightly depending on rounding. Each atom of hydrogen has a mass of about 1.01 which gives a total mass of about 12.12 grams per mole for 12 atoms of hydrogen. When accounting for rounding differences, the two values add together to total about 72.15 grams per mole for each molecule of pentane.

What is the difference between phagocytosis and pinocytosis?

Phagocytosis can be performed by certain single-celled organisms like the amoeba or by one of the human body's cells, such as a white blood cell. An organism like the amoeba uses phagocytosis as a form of feeding. In contrast, the white blood cells use phagocytosis as a defense mechanism against bacteria, viruses, dust particles and other foreign bodies. During the process of phagocytosis, the particle and the cell, or phagocyte, must first adhere to each other. How does genetics affect blood type?

Humans have two blood type genes, according to Baylor Scott & White Health. Each parent passes one of these on to his offspring. For blood type O to occur, both parents must have at least one O gene. The O blood type only occurs when a child inherits O from both parents. When a child inherits A and O or A and A, his blood genes are AO or AA, respectively, and his blood type is A. When a child inherits B and O or B and B, his blood genes are BO or BB, respectively, and his blood type is B. What are the products of incomplete combustion?

Complete combustion of a hydrocarbon fuel results in very few byproducts, primarily carbon dioxide and water along with a few oxides. If there is not enough oxygen for complete combustion, or a heat sink of some sort interferes with the combustion process, the fuel does not burn completely. What is the speed of light traveling through air?

The speed of light in a vacuum is equal to 670,600,000 miles per hour. The fastest medium in which light can travel is through no matter, which is a vacuum. Any matter slows light down, but the degree to which is slows light is determined by the medium itself. The index of refraction of air is 1.0003, which is substantially lower than solids or liquids.

Why is litter a problem?

When trash is thrown from a car, it may hit another car's windshield — a distraction that could cause an accident. Running over litter or trying to avoid litter can also lead to vehicle accidents. According to Don't Trash Arizona, about 25,000 car accidents each year are a result of litter on roads.\n\nLitter can be harmful to animals, who may try to swallow pieces of trash or become entangled in it. What is a cord of wood?

The word "cord" is sometimes used loosely by firewood dealers. Most firewood is sold in pieces of 12 to 16 inches in length, suitable for a home fireplace or wood-burning stove. A 4 by 8 foot stack of 16 inch firewood, sometimes called a "face cord," is only about a third of an actual cord in volume.

How are echinoderms and chordates related?

All echinoderms are marine. Many chordates, including humans, live on land. Examples of echinoderms include brittle stars, sand dollars, sea stars, sea lilies, sea urchins and sea cucumbers. Most chordates, though not all, are vertebrates. All amphibians, birds, fish, lampreys, mammals and reptiles are chordates. Invertebrate chordates have two different types: the tunicates and the lancelets. The tunicates are also known as sea squirts.

How does faulting occur?

Deep under the surface, rock can get very hot and soft. The movement of this layer relative to the surface puts stress on the uppermost layers of rock. Rock near the surface tends to be cooler and less malleable, which allows the stress from underneath to build until the surface rock cracks.
